Man Faces 3rd OWI After March Crash

31-year-old was barely understandable after accident, according to criminal complaint.

A South Milwaukee man is facing his third drunken driving charge after he was involved in a March accident in Oak Creek.

Jason Lang, 31, was charged in Milwaukee County Circuit Court Monday with one count of third-offense operating while intoxciated. If convicted, he could face up to one year in Milwaukee County Jail and $2,000 in fines.

According to the criminal complaint:

On March 9, arrived at the scene of an accident near S. 15th Ave. and E. Puetz Road and found Lang stumbling around and smelling of intoxicants.

Officers were barely able to understand Lang and he was taken to a hospital for a blood test, which showed he had a high amount of Temazepan in his blood stream. Police also arrested a second person who allegedly fled the scene .

Lang was previously convicted of OWI in 2010 and September. He will make his initial court appearance Jan. 12.
